Sterling Capital Management LLC Lowers Holdings in Monster Beverage Corporation $MNST

Sterling Capital Management LLC reduced its stake in shares of Monster Beverage Corporation (NASDAQ:MNSTFree Report) by 15.7%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 61,152 shares of the company’s stock after selling 11,398 shares during the quarter. Sterling Capital Management LLC’s holdings in Monster Beverage were worth $4,431,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Monster Beverage Stock Up 0.6%

Shares of MNST opened at $96.38 on Friday. The business has a fifty day moving average of $85.97 and a 200 day moving average of $80.58. The company has a market cap of $94.26 billion, a PE ratio of 46.56, a P/E/G ratio of 3.17 and a beta of 0.54. Monster Beverage Corporation has a 52-week low of $58.09 and a 52-week high of $97.87.

Monster Beverage (NASDAQ:MNST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 8th. The company reported $0.58 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.53 by $0.05. Monster Beverage had a net margin of 23.11% and a return on equity of 26.86%. The business had revenue of $2.32 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.16 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$0.47 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 22.6%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Monster Beverage Corporation will post 2.31 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Monster Beverage announced that its Board of Directors has initiated a share buyback program on Friday, May 15th that allows the company to buyback $500.00 million in shares. This buyback authorization allows the company to repurchase up to 0.6% of its shares through open market purchases. Monster Beverage Company Profile

(Free Report)

Monster Beverage Corporation (NASDAQ: MNST) is an American beverage company best known for its Monster Energy brand of energy drinks. The company’s product portfolio centers on carbonated energy beverages and a range of complementary ready-to-drink offerings, including energy coffees, hydration beverages and other flavored functional drinks. Monster markets multiple sub-brands and flavor variants to address different consumer segments and consumption occasions.

Originally organized around the Hansen’s Natural line of juices and sodas, the company pivoted toward the energy drink category and formally adopted the Monster Beverage name in the early 2010s to reflect its strategic focus.
